Frontend UI Software Engineer

Kai is the AI company rebuilding cybersecurity for the machine-speed era. Founded by second time founders and trusted by Fortune 500 enterprises, Kai is building a future where security has no categories, no silos, and no human speed bottlenecks. The Kai Agentic AI Platform replaces fragmented, human-limited workflows with agentic AI systems that continuously contextualize, assess, reason, and execute security work at machine speed - making human defenders, superhuman.


Why Join Kai

  • Well-funded: With $125M raised, we have the capital, runway, and resolve to rebuild cybersecurity from first principles.
  • Proven: We've earned the trust of Fortune 500 and Global 1000 companies, and we're just getting started. Their confidence in Kai reflects what we've built: an AI-powered cybersecurity platform that performs at the scale and speed the enterprise demands.
  • Experienced founders: Our founding team consists of second-time entrepreneurs, each with over 20 years of experience in the cybersecurity industry. Their proven expertise and vision drive our ambitious goals.
  • World-class leadership team: Our Heads of AI, Engineering, and Product bring extensive experience from some of the world’s most influential companies, ensuring top-tier mentorship, direction, and vision.
  • Frontier AI Applied Research Team: Our researchers operate at the leading edge of agentic AI systems, translating breakthrough capabilities into real-world cybersecurity applications.
  • Generous compensation: We offer highly competitive salaries, equity options, and a supportive work environment. Your contributions will be valued and rewarded as we grow together.


Why This Role Matters

This role serves as the bridge between complex application logic and the people who interact with it every day. By transforming technical requirements into fast, responsive, and intuitive interfaces, the UI Developer ensures that users experience clarity, speed, and reliability. In a world where digital experiences shape trust and adoption, thoughtful UI development directly drives product success and customer confidence.


What You’ll Do

  • Develop and maintain scalable front-end applications using React, TypeScript, GraphQL, and Next.js.
  • Implement responsive designs that provide seamless experiences across web, tablet, and large screens.
  • Collaborate with UX/UI designers to translate design mockups into high-quality, pixel-perfect interfaces.
  • Integrate with GraphQL APIs and optimize front-end data fetching for performance and reliability.
  • Build and maintain component libraries and design systems to ensure consistency and reusability.
  • Work with backend and DevOps teams to ensure smooth deployment, testing, and scalability of applications.
  • Contribute to code reviews, best practices, and technical documentation.


What We’re Looking For

  • 3–10 years of professional experience in UI/front-end development.
  • Strong proficiency in React, TypeScript, Next.js (good to have), and GraphQL (good to know, not a must)
  • Demonstrated experience building responsive and adaptive UIs.
  • Solid understanding of JavaScript (ES6+), HTML5, and CSS3.
  • Experience with state management libraries (Redux, Apollo, or equivalent).
  • Strong debugging, performance optimization, and problem-solving skills.
  • Familiarity with Git, CI/CD workflows, and Agile development practices.
  • Bonus: Experience with server-side rendering (SSR) and static site generation (SSG) in Next.js.
  • Bonus: Strong eye for design and usability with experience collaborating in tools like Figma.
  • Bonus: Exposure to cloud platforms (AWS, Azure, or GCP) and DevOps pipelines.

Engineering

San Jose, CA

Share on:

Terms of servicePrivacyCookiesPowered by Rippling